Police open investigation into swastikas found in residential London neighbourhood

The Metropolitan Police Service has opened an investigation after two swastikas were daubed on a wall in Kentish Town, London. Police went to the scene before the swastikas were cleaned off. Journalist forces antisemite to disembark from train for claiming “ISIS was created by the Jews”

British journalist James Bloodworth has posted on Facebook that he forced a man to disembark from a train after he made antisemitic comments. Bloodworth said that he had an altercation with the man after he refused to remove his bags from Bloodworth’s seat at the start of the journey.
